In honor of Sheriff " Big John " Williams . Lowndes Co. ALHAYNEVILLE, Ala. - The community that Sheriff “ Big John ” Williams once served is revving up their engines to continue his legacy.
All the proceeds from the rally go towards a scholarship fund in Big John’s name, benefitting Lowndes County high school seniors.The event made more special for the Sheriff’s loved ones, as it comes the day after his birthday and the day before Father’s Day.
